In Sophos Web Appliance (SWA) before 4.3.1.2, a section of the machine's configuration utilities for adding (and detecting) Active Directory servers was vulnerable to remote command injection, aka NSWA-1314.

Remote command injection vulnerability in Sophos Web Appliance's Active Directory server configuration utilities. An authenticated attacker with access to the AD configuration section could inject arbitrary OS commands through unsanitized input parameters, leading to complete system compromise.

MitigationUpgrade Sophos Web Appliance to version 4.3.1.2 or later. If immediate patching is not feasible, limit administrative interface access to trusted IP addresses and monitor for anomalous AD server configuration attempts.

  1. Identify Sophos Web Appliance installation
    Check the product name displayed in the web interface header or check system documentation/inventory for Sophos Web Appliance deployment
    Affected if The target is not Sophos Web Appliance, this CVE does not apply
  2. Determine installed version
    Locate the version number in the Sophos Web Appliance admin interface (typically under System > Maintenance > Version) or check via CLI if available
    Affected if Installed version is 4.3.1.1 or earlier, placing it within the affected range
  3. Verify Active Directory integration is configured
    Check if the appliance has Active Directory server configuration enabled under the directory services or AD configuration section of the admin interface
    Affected if AD integration is not configured, the specific attack vector is not present; however, the vulnerable code may still exist in the installation
  4. Confirm access to AD configuration interface
    Review user accounts and their permissions to determine if any accounts have access to the AD server configuration utilities section
    Affected if Untrusted or compromised accounts have access to AD configuration, an authenticated attacker could exploit the injection flaw

Environment is affected if running Sophos Web Appliance version 4.3.1.1 or earlier with Active Directory integration enabled and accessible to untrusted users.
